Abstract: |
An archaeological watching brief was carried out at Gilroes Cemetery in Leicester by University of Leicester Archaeological Services in August and September 2011. The site was located on the north-eastern side of the existing cemetery, adjacent to Anstey Lane (SK 56559 06680). No significant archaeological deposits or finds were identified during the course of the work. However, the remains of medieval ridge and furrow agriculture were observed and post-medieval and modern pottery indicates that night soil was spread on the fields. The archive will be held by Leicester City Council under the Accession number A10.2011. |
